mobile menu
mobile menu
About
FAQ
Home
Specialties
Danville, IL, 61832
Dr. Ostin Warren PSYD
Dr.
Ostin Warren PSYD
1900 E Main St
Danville, IL, 61832
(217) 554-4867
Physician
Profile
Ostin Warren. His primary practice is as a Psychologist.